One problem is that so many airport and airline websites state that aircraft have ‘departed’ when all that means is they have left the stand. EZY OTP (on time performance) is based on when they push back from
Stand.
Always thought this was misleading as someone, not unreasonably, thinks the flight they are waiting for will be landing at the destination in xx minutes but it could well be still on ground at departure airport waiting for a slot time. Today the A320 did push back and then returned to stand but as Expessflight stated, even at that stage it was planned to go to Stansted.
